Introduction / Market Overview
The Extended Reality (XR) Market encompasses immersive technologies, including vir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R), and mixed reality (MR). These technologies create interactive environments that enhance users' experiences across various sectors, including gaming, education, healthcare, and retail. By blending the physical and digital worlds, XR solutions enable innovative applications such as virtual training simulations, immersive educational tools, and interactive marketing campaigns.
The advantages of extended reality over traditional experiences include enhanced engagement, improved learning retention, and the ability to visualize complex data in a user-friendly manner. As industries increasingly recognize the potential of XR technologies to drive innovation and improve customer experiences, the demand for these solutions is expanding rapidly across key sectors.

Growth Driver
A primary growth driver for the Extended Reality Market is the rapid advancement of technology coupled with increasing investments in XR solutions. Industries are leveraging XR to enhance operational efficiency and improve user engagement, particularly in training and simulation scenarios. The rise of 5G technology, providing faster data transfer rates and lower latency, is further fueling this growth, as it allows for more complex and interactive experiences without delays.
Market Opportunity
The increasing adoption of XR in industries such as healthcare presents a significant market opportunity. Medical professionals are using VR for surgical training, patient education, and pain management, while AR facilitates better visualization during complex procedures. As technology improves, these applications are expected to expand, driving further investment and innovation in the XR space.
